What is a 3D cartoon?
What is the difference between a 2D and a 3D drawing? Well, the answer is pretty simple.
When nosotros draw in 2D (2 dimensions), we produce a sketch on our newspaper with no sense of volume. All that is really taken into account is the width and summit of our object. Just when nosotros depict in 3D, we include a third dimension: depth.
It's stating the obvious to say that drawing in 3D makes a drawing more realistic, because that it'south more faithful to the small details that the middle observes in reality. Information technology copies reliefs and distances, and keeps the same proportions every bit in reality, for instance when cartoon a face up.

How do I Depict in Perspective?
Perspective is the technique which allows you to draw an object in space in three dimensions. The drawer takes into account the depth of the scene and reproduces the object as it is perceived from their ain point of view.
Cavalier perspective consists of giving an object volume by adding a structure of parallel lines. This is a blazon of drawing that we predominantly detect in geometry to correspond a cube, for example.
Linear perspective is ofttimes used in drawing. In order to create a proficient linear perspective, we generally concentrate on these two elements:
- A horizon line
- One or more vanishing points.
From these elements, by drawing lines we tin can create a filigree that volition piece of work as visual guides for cartoon the diverse parts of our scene.
There are many different types of linear perspectives, which helps the drawer create depth and volume in their work:
- Frontal perspective: the heart is facing the scene front-on. The cartoon is based on the horizon line at eye level, and all the lines meet at one sole vanishing bespeak.
- Oblique perspective: we encounter this in two directions. The composition has two vanishing points. This type of perspective uses ii vanishing points, allowing you to draw cubes and other geometric shapes past taking into account their real shape and depth.
- Aerial perspective: hither nosotros take into account all the dimensions of the object by working on its representation with three vanishing points. This is the most realistic perspective, predominantly used in architecture to represent furniture, for example.
Mastering drawing in perspective is necessary to create a realistic drawing and give it book, such as drawing a hand for case. Drawing in 3D is not nigh improvisation. You need to really use your eyes and take in the proportions of your object as faithfully as possible. Representing characters or objects by properly observing the effects of depth is crucial for keen 3D drawing.
Some artists use another type of perspective too: atmospheric perspective.
Information technology could be compared to a camera and its focus. This perspective is based on impressions. This ways that whatever is in the foreground is drawn in a clear and precise way, but the more you lot look in depth, the more the details are unclear. Some artists also play on colours and gradients as well to create this event of depth: the cooler the colours, the less precise the details of the scene.
This is a technique developed and used by Flemish painters of the 15th century, just information technology is also seen in the work of Leonardo da Vinci, notably in the Mona Lisa.
How Do I Create an Optical Illusion Issue in a Drawing?
Those who main the fine art of drawing in perspective achieve an even more impressive effect in their work. The objects seem to literally bound of the page and come to life.
When a drawing is successful it gives the impression of coming to life and actually takes on three dimensions. Information technology'southward a great commencement for designing an eye-catching company logo also!
This impression is an optical illusion, which is only noticeable from ane specific angle. When you look at an anamorphic drawing you have to expect at it a certain way in lodge to see the result in 3D. From any other bending, you'll only meet a distorted image.
How Do I Create a Flick that Jumps off the Page?
You need to learn the correct technique. Information technology'south not simply necessary to know how to distort an prototype correctly, simply for the upshot to be actually realistic, you lot as well need to principal basic drawing techniques. There are quite a few steps to get from the first sketch to the finished piece. You will to know how to draw each detail of your subject, and also how to pigment or colour your drawing for outcome.
To create an anamorphic drawing, you'll need to misconstrue the image that you wish to correspond on paper. The main techniques that volition assist you lot depict an anamorphic image are:
- Utilise a photographic camera to capture your object in a photograph, which you lot can print or display to help you sketch information technology accurately
- Apply computer software to misconstrue the object that yous wish to stand for so that yous can draw it easily
- Utilise a grid system to describe the object in its correct proportions
- Cut out part of the outline of the drawing to reinforce the 3D impression
- Employ multiple sheets or fold a sheet to attain the desired volume effect
Many artists have been able to primary the art of anamorphic drawing, such every bit Leon Keer and Kurt Wenner. You can sometimes fifty-fifty come up beyond 3D fine art on the ground or on walls in public spaces. Many street artists produce striking realist pieces.
Between gaping holes in the middle of the pavement and sharks protruding from the road, there are many performances from artists such as Edgar Mueller and Julian Beever, for instance, that are actually impressive.

Which Pens Should I Utilize for 3D Drawing?
Because 3D drawing besides entails virtual reality, 3D press and three-dimensional writing, information technology's impossible to talk nearly the subject without mentioning 3D pens.
So what is a 3D pen?
Information technology'southward an innovative tool which operates on the same principle as a 3D printer. The 3D pen allows yous to write and describe in 3 dimensions with its simple function: the pen heats the plastic, which cools when released onto a support. This means you tin can create 3D structures really easily and quickly.
You can use an object to help y'all draw contours in 3D, build parts and gather them, or only let your imagination run free!
A 3D pen can contain one of two types of plastic: ABS or PLA. The option of plastic that you opt for is important for different types of projects.
- ABS is a cloth that cools instantly, so it'southward ideal for 3D drawing. It's a plastic made from petroleum, which allows you to easily create unlike shapes which will hold their structure well. Y'all can make all sorts – straight and curved lines, spirals, and geometric shapes. It'due south as well very useful for 2D writing creations that you can peel off and utilise as you wish.
- PLA cools less speedily, taking longer to solidify. PLA is mainly composed of starch and natural materials, and is biodegradable. It is better suited for 3D writing as information technology adheres well to a support, such equally paper-thin, metal or ceramics. It'southward useful for drawing 2D images that won't peel off.

How do I cull a 3D pen?
Unlike 3D printers which are but bachelor to particular groups of people, 3D pens appeal to a big demographic considering they are affordable and accessible.
Both amateur and professional person artists are intrigued by the idea of 3D drawing, and it amuses children for hours – it'due south the perfect hobby for those who love building and realising their designs, providing infinite opportunities for invention!
The commencement 3D pen was the 3Doodler. Today it's in its tertiary generation, and this latest version is more than precise and reliable than e'er, at an affordable price.
There are many different models of 3D pens today. They are available at all prices, with varying pick depending on your personal needs and expectations. There are a few elements to take into business relationship when making your choice, such equally:
- The design and weight of the pen: this is an important element to facilitate the handling and accuracy of your 3D drawing.
- LCD display: another important point when using a 3D pen is monitoring its functions, such as the pen'southward temperature. The temperature makes it possible to experiment with the effects of the plastic.
- The cost: obviously, your upkeep will influence your option of pen, merely this will likewise affect the quality of pen that you will look for and beget. Y'all can find 3D pens for less that £50, but they aren't always the best quality.
- The brand: among the field of big names in the world of 3D pens, the mentionable ones are 3Doodler, Lix pens, Yestech 3D, 7tech 3D and GENESIS.
